Tobias Wens joined Boston Consulting Group in November 2010. He is a core member of the Restructuring & Turnaround Task Force and BCG's Transform practice. His client work focuses on restructuring and turnarounds in various industries and he has led a large number of complex operational turnarounds and financial restructurings, especially for mid-sized companies. His work includes independent business reviews (IBRs), holistic turnaround concepts, going-concern prognoses, cash release and net working capital management, and insolvency support.
Tobias delivers short-term impact for companies facing challenges from concept development to implementation.
Before joining BCG, Tobias worked for over two years at Roland Berger.
